I am on L1 visa (blanket) going to apply for my wife's L2 visa. Our surnames were different (before marriage) and her passport still has different surname.

My question is, should I get her name changed in the passport (to match my surname and middle name) before I apply for her visa? Or just showing marriage certificate is sufficient? I am really confused and need some expert advice.

I got the reply to this question while referring to other website,
immihelp.com/visas/l1/l2docs.html

Looks like its not necessary to change the name in passport. But visa will be issued on passport's name.

I don't mean to discourage you but 2-3 weeks is very difficult.

You might want to first register the marriage as soon as you reach India. That way you can atleast start the passport paperwork. Changing the name in the passport requires the issuance of a fresh passport and this does take some time depending on your local passport office. Also you will have to have each other's names endoresed in the passport. Also, once you get the passport you will need to get the appointment with the consulate for stamping. The appointment will have to be after the marriage since the consultate folks will ask for marriage photos.

I think you should plan for atleast 4 weeks vacation time. Also you can leave on a Friday and come back on a sunday to extend your vacation by 4 days or so.
